Continue ReadingAfter winning seven straight games heading into the state playoffs, district champion Jupiter felt pretty good about making a strong run.
While feeling confident in the opening state playoff contest at home against Boca Raton, head coach Jason Kradman and his Warriors found out that nothing was a given. Not in this sport.
The 48-41 setback was indeed a show for this program that finished the year at 9-2.
With the off-season beginning much earlier than expected, the focus immediately turned to the off-season.
If this team was going to get back and take things one step further in 2024, what happened in spring and summer would be essential.
As spring winds down, the focus will be on summer, and relying on a rising senior (2025) class that has the chance to be special.
Here is a look at some of those 2025 players to keep an eye on:
